Tasha built The Launch Guild to be a course-launch support and digital marketing implementation agency, supporting established coaches and course creators with course and podcast launches, operations and systems management, and content management and repurposing. Her team is over 20 members strong and works together to support their clients and being able to put their focus back into their zone of genius. Additionally, she mentors virtual support pros, VA’s, and OBM’s who are passionate and ready to grow their business, while living life on their terms. Tasha also is the host of the How She Did That podcast, a podcast where virtual assistants, online business managers, and project managers learn business and tech tips. Tasha is an Air Force wife to her husband Scott and step-mom to Grace and Meredith, and a work from home dog mom to Stanley and Boomer. In her spare time, Tasha watches true crime tv, sings karaoke, and tends to her organic vegetable garden. Tasha considers her businesses to have two sides. The agency side does full-service launch support for established coaches and course creators. It includes podcast launches, course launches, membership launches, and more. In this podcast episode, guest Tasha Booth joins us and shares her journey from the musical theater stage, to her transition to full-time work, and finally making her ultimate leap when she launched The Launch Guild. She also dives into how she has grown her company to have two very unique sides to give her clients a full-service experience based exactly on what they need in their business.
